Canton

“Gateway to Maxwell Game Preserve”


Canton is located six miles south of the Maxwell Refuge and provides full services – groceries, gas, home-cooked meals, and most of your daily conveniences.

McPherson State Fishing Lake (Canton Lake)

46 acres, boating, boat ramps, picnic areas, basic camping, fishing piers, nature trails

1883 Jail

The pioneer 1883 jail on Allen Street can be seen by appointment.
